Description
Y15 hydrochloride, also known as FAK Inhibitor 14, is a direct FAK autophosphorylation inhibitor, blocking phosphorylation of Y397 with an IC50 value of about 1 μM. Y15 decreases viability, clonogenicity, and cell attachment in thyroid cancer cell lines and synergizes with targeted therapeutics. Y15 was shown to decrease cancer growth in vitro and in vivo.

In Vitro Activity
In each cell line Y15 inhibited pY397 and total FAK expression in a dose-dependent manner. TT was the most sensitive cell line with effective inhibition of pY397 expression by 3 μM Y15 (Figure 2A). TPC1 cells had inhibition of phosphorylated FAK and total FAK expression at 30 μM Y15 (Figure 2B). K1 had Y397-FAK and FAK inhibition at 50 μM (Figure 2C) and BCPAP had inhibition of pY397 and FAK expression levels at 40 μM Y15 (Figure 2D). Thus, Y15 decreased pY397 and total FAK levels in a dose-dependent manner, most in the medullary thyroid cancer cell line and to a lesser extent in the papillary thyroid cancer cell lines.
Reference: Oncotarget. 2014 Sep; 5(17): 7945-7959. https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pmc/articles/PMC4202172/
In Vivo Activity
Although weight-loss was similar in both infected groups [Fig. 2B], three doses of Y15 were sufficient to significantly extend survival time by 3 days and increase survival [Fig. 2C]. Importantly, DMSO-treated mice either succumbed to the infection (4/8) or were euthanized based on reaching symptom end-points before reaching body weight-loss cut-off. In contrast, most (7/8) Y15-treated mice were euthanized due to reaching body weight-loss cut-off with mild symptoms being observed. These data indicate that short-term prophylactic intranasal administration of Y15 results in prolonged survival of an extremely susceptible host.
Reference: Virology. 2019 Aug;534:54-63. https://p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/31176924/
